Error about Supreme Court Building Motto
by bwilsonfan

The actual phrase etched on the facade of the U.S. Supreme Court building is "Equal Justice Under Law," not "Equal Justice for All," as written by the authors. While this is a minor point in the context of the entire article, these two phrases are not synonymous, in my view. The actual etched phrase necessarily is more circumscribed a concept than the erroneous one in the article--reflecting the constitutional principle, as I see it, that the courts cannot always redress all ills, even if "equal justice" is not being served.
